MacBook Pros have a serious Wifi problems it seems.

Our whole team has MacBook Pros. We paid a lot of money for them, and we set them up with BootCamp so our team could be really effective.

Turns out a bunch of us are having horrible problems with the Wifi dropping out (in Windows and OS X). You’ll surf fine for 20 second and it pauses for a minute then BANG the pages load and you’re good for another 20-30 seconds.

I don’t see any official response from Apple about this, but folks are really on fire about it on Apple’s Message Boards. It’s not an OS issue, and it is not a software issue it seems (we’ve reinstalled all the software).

One thing that seems to have helped is turning off bluetooth.
